Freeze warnings, record lows, and rivaling Alaska. If your hangover has kept you bedridden all week, you need to know that it’s cold (very cold) in Phoenix. 

The low temperature of the first full night of 2019 in the Valley just about broke a six-year record. The low at Phoenix Sky Harbor International Airport dropped to 30 degrees, just one degree shy of the record of 29 degrees on January 15, 2013. At one point Tuesday morning, Phoenix was colder than Anchorage Alaska. Oh, and if that’s not enough, it snowed in Scottsdale on New Year’s Eve. 

Parts of Northern Arizona were blanketed by snow. Payson, Holbrook, and the Grand Canyon were among the places turned into a winter wonderland. 

What now? Pay attention to freeze warnings that can affect plants and piping outside your home.
